CVE-2024-5450 is a critical-severity vulnerability rated 9.1/10 on the CVSS scale. The Bug Library WordPress plugin before 2.1.1 does not check the file type on user-submitted bug reports, allowing an unauthenticated user to upload PHP files. EPSS estimates a 0.75% chance of exploitation in the next 30 days.
